About

Gillingham sits in North Dorset on the River Stour close to the county boundary with Wiltshire. The town acts as a service centre for surrounding farms and villages, with shops, post office and a secondary school. Narrow lanes and country tracks lead from the town into fields and patches of woodland that reach the edge of Cranborne Chase. River Stour meadows and floodplain channels are used by anglers and walkers and form part of local land management and drainage.

The railway station is on the line between Exeter and London Waterloo; timetables and station signs use the name Gillingham (Dorset) to distinguish it from the Kent town. Regular trains and local buses connect residents to larger towns for markets and services. Footpaths run along the Stour and across arable fields, with public rights of way linking farms and hamlets. The town retains a short high street and parish council buildings that reflect its role as a local hub.

Area overview

On average Gillingham has moderate deprivation and moderate crime levels, with around 39 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. Approximately 13.2%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income per household in Gillingham is £45,263 per year. There are 3 schools in Gillingham: 2 primary (0 Outstanding and 0 Good) and 1 secondary (0 Outstanding and 1 Good). Gillingham is home to around 7,315 people, with a population density of about 1,352.0 per km2.

Property prices in Gillingham

Based on 173 recent sales, the median property price is £270,000 in Gillingham area, with individual transactions ranging from £55,000 up to £735,000.
